The global N-Lauroyl-L-lysine market, valued at $211.9 million in 2025, is poised for significant growth. While the exact CAGR is not provided, considering the increasing demand for natural and effective cosmetic ingredients, a conservative estimate places the annual growth rate between 5-7% over the forecast period (2025-2033). Key drivers include the rising popularity of natural and organic cosmetics, coupled with the increasing awareness of the benefits of N-Lauroyl-L-lysine as a mild, yet effective, surfactant and conditioning agent in skincare, haircare, and makeup products. The market is segmented by purity level (≥99%, ≥98%, Others), application (Makeup Products, Skin Care Products, Hair Care Products, Others), and geography. The high purity grades (≥99% and ≥98%) dominate the market due to their superior performance in cosmetic formulations. The skincare segment holds the largest market share, driven by the ingredient's ability to improve skin texture and hydration. Leading companies like Ajinomoto, Daito Kasei Kogyo, and Protameen Chemicals are key players, driving innovation and expanding the market reach through strategic partnerships and new product launches. Geographical expansion is also expected, with Asia Pacific and North America representing significant growth opportunities.


The market's restraints primarily revolve around the relatively high cost of production compared to synthetic alternatives and the potential for supply chain disruptions. However, the growing consumer preference for naturally derived ingredients and stringent regulations on synthetic chemicals in cosmetics are mitigating these challenges. The surging demand for N-Lauroyl-L-lysine is primarily fueled by its increasing adoption in the cosmetics and personal care sector. Its unique properties as a mild surfactant and conditioning agent make it an ideal ingredient for a wide range of products, including shampoos, conditioners, lotions, and makeup. The growing consumer preference for natural and gentle skincare products further boosts demand. This trend is particularly strong in developed economies with a high level of consumer awareness regarding the ingredients used in their personal care products. Furthermore, the expanding global population and rising disposable incomes are contributing to the increased consumption of personal care products, thereby driving market growth. The ongoing research and development efforts to explore new applications for N-Lauroyl-L-lysine are also a significant factor. Manufacturers are constantly looking for innovative ingredients to enhance the performance and appeal of their products, and N-Lauroyl-L-lysine’s versatility makes it an attractive choice. Finally, the increasing focus on sustainability and eco-friendly ingredients within the cosmetics industry provides another significant tailwind for the market's growth. N-Lauroyl-L-lysine is seen as a comparatively sustainable alternative to some harsher chemical surfactants, aligning with consumer preference for environmentally responsible products.
Despite its strong growth trajectory, the N-Lauroyl-L-lysine market faces several challenges. Fluctuations in raw material prices, particularly the price of lauric acid and lysine, can significantly impact production costs and profitability. The global supply chain's vulnerability to disruptions caused by geopolitical events or natural disasters poses a considerable risk to manufacturers. Maintaining consistent product quality and meeting stringent regulatory requirements in various markets also presents a significant hurdle. Competition from other surfactants and conditioning agents is another key challenge. Companies need to continuously innovate and differentiate their products to maintain a competitive edge. Furthermore, the development and implementation of efficient and cost-effective production processes are crucial for sustaining profitability and scaling operations to meet the growing demand. Lastly, ensuring the sustainable and responsible sourcing of raw materials is important for maintaining the positive perception of N-Lauroyl-L-lysine within the growing market for environmentally conscious products.
